Zcash Completes Formal Verification of Ironwood Shielded Pool Against Counterfeiting Risks

Zcash researchers have completed formal verification of the network’s Ironwood shielded pool, publishing a machine-checked proof that excludes undetectable counterfeiting bugs under its stated cryptographic assumptions. The work establishes that the new pool cannot distribute more value than has publicly entered it.

The proof, prepared in the Lean programming language, contains more than 2,700 theorems and required more than a month of effort by three teams of researchers and cryptographers. It addresses the components required for balance integrity, including the zero-knowledge proof system, circuit rules and ledger-level accounting. Privacy properties of Ironwood fall outside the scope of the verification.

Ironwood was introduced in the NU6.3 network upgrade following discovery of a vulnerability in the preceding Orchard shielded pool. That flaw could in theory have permitted undetectable creation of ZEC tokens. Developers reported no evidence that the issue had been exploited. The new pool aims to reinforce confidence in the integrity of the token supply.

Assets moving from Orchard into Ironwood must pass through a public accounting checkpoint known as a turnstile. The mechanism is intended to block any hypothetical excess coins from entering the new pool. As balances exit Orchard, the process may also generate additional evidence regarding whether the earlier pool was compromised.
